Programme Name and Duration

The Post Graduate Diploma in Computer Science aims at equipping students with advanced skills in Computer Science.

Target Group

The program is designed for graduates who wish to gain advanced knowledge in Computer Science. The broad target groups include but not limited to:

  • those interested in pursuing both academic and professional careers requiring advanced Computer Science knowledge.
  • professionals interested pursuing careers in the fields of computer security, data science, network security, analytical, software engineering/software development, and cloud computing among others.
  • those interested in pursuing Masters research in Computer Science.
program Duration

The duration of the program is two semesters and one recess term spread in one year. Each semester has fifteen weeks of studying and two weeks of examinations. A recess term is made up of ten weeks.

Tuition Fees

Tuition fees for privately sponsored students is 5,000,000 Uganda Shillings per academic year for Ugandans and 12,780,000 Uganda Shillings for International students.

 

Programme Objectives

  1. To provide students with in-depth knowledge of the theoretical and practical aspects of Computer Science so as to satisfy the technological needs in the private and public sector.
  2. To provide students with advanced knowledge and special skills set in the key areas of computer security, computer programming, data science, and cloud computing.
  3. To equip students with the knowledge and skills necessary to meet the ever-evolving demands of the Computer Science profession
  4. To provide students with skills to deploy and manage Computer infrastructure in organizations so as to improve their effectiveness
  5. To provide students with research skills which will help then grow with the technological advancements as well as help them participate in the development of new technologies

 

Entry Requirements

To be admitted to the Post Graduate Diploma in Computer Science, the candidate must hold an undergraduate degree in Computer Science, Computer Engineering, and Software Engineering or a closely related field from a recognized university/institution.

Candidates from closely related fields should have taken core computer science courses in undergraduate studies including: compiler design, automata and complexity, object-oriented programming languages, data structures and algorithms, computer architecture, mathematics particularly in linear algebra statistics and calculus.

 

Programme Structure

Year I Semester I

Mandatory for all students

CodeNameLHPHCHCU
MCS 7101Cloud Technologies and Architectures3060604
MCS 7102Data Security and Privacy3060604
MCS 7103Machine Learning6030454
MCS 7106Advanced Topics in Computer Science3060604
 Total Credit Units   16

Year I Semester II

Software and Systems Security Option

CodeNameLHPHCHCU
MCS 7201Computer Systems Security3060604
MCS 7227Data Analytics and Visualization6030454
MIT 7116Research Methodology4530604
 Electives (Select 1)    
MCS 7203Cloud and Web Security3060604
MCS 7203Cloud and Web Security3060604
MCS 7204Deep Learning3060604
MCS 7205Digital Forensics3060604
 Total Credit Units   16

Artificial Intelligence and Data Science Option

CodeNameLHPHCHCU
MCS 7208Data Mining3060604
MCS 7227Data Analytics and Visualization6060304
MIT 7116Research Methodology4530604
 Electives (Select 1)    
MCS 7203Cloud and Web Security3060604
MCS 7204Deep Learning3060604
MCS 7205Digital Forensics3060604
 Total Credit Units   16

Recess Term

CodeNameLHPHCHCU
PGD 7307Postgraduate Diploma Project   5
 Total Credit Units   5

Minimum Graduation Load: 37 credit units